SC 130 Physical Science laboratory five images

In this laboratory the students tested various materials for heat conductivity. The investigation included determining which materials conducted heat quickest and which conducted the most heat as measured by temperature in Celsius. The students then report data to the board and work as a class to decide how to best present their findings.

Discussion at this juncture centered on the difficulty that not everyone measured their temperatures at the same time. The students had already reached a collective decision that any chart had to reflect a common point in time.

One student wanted to make their own coffee. The student wanted to add the ground coffee to their cup and add hot water. I explained that the coffee was ground coffee and would not dissolve. The student appeared to hear this, but went ahead and added the ground coffee to hot water in their cup. The coffee did not dissolve despite working the mixture with a spoon. A few other students began to explain to the student why the ground coffee did not dissolve. The student began laughing and admitted that they had never seen ground coffee before. The lab presents many learning experiences, not all of them designed.
